SCHOOLBOY WINS FISHING CONTEST
Hastings schoolboy Michael Trimmer, 13 (pictured), who weighed in a 101b rainbow trout last Thursday afternoon, won the heaviest fish section of the Leisure Time fishing contest which concluded on Sunday Michael took the prize from Mr D. L. Studholme, whose 91b lOoz fish gained the contest lead on the Thursday morning. Mr B. J. Perry, of Havelock North produced a 91b 5oz fish on the opening day of the contest, December 26, but was unseated at the 11th hour by Mr Stud holme who in turn had to concede the honour to Michael Trimmer. The prize for the longest fish went to MrH Levick. The average catch per day during the contest was six and the weighing station handled a total of 180 trout.
